I have a spezial issue...
I have hade some AP-Groups with spezial charakters ...like ü,ä... al that german language stuff...
Now i have the Problem that i can not delete these AP-Groups (no WLAN or AP assigned).
Not via GUI or CLI!!!
Is there any hidden command to force the delete???

#what code are you running, i see relevant bug CSCtg45622, CSCtg42627 on 6.0 code, similar issue and workaround was delete the AP group via cli. If this doesn't work then try the below option.
#Pull the config from WLC, remove the affected AP group from config, apply the edited config back to WLC, reboot the WLC.
